I´m really exited about DP7.02 and Amplidoods GUI GOLD mod.
I recently upgraded from DP 5.13 and got very dissapointed with the original DP7 GUI.
But the AmpGUI7 mods made me stay in DP7 from day one and made me forget all about DP 5.13.
Today I feel, compaired to DP7, DP5.13 seems suddenly so limited.

DP7.02 is rocking on my system. Got some MAS errors in the beginning but this is okay now and everything feels solid. I have been using DP7.02 for >10 hrs a day in 3 days now. Running it with plenty of plug ins, doing a lot of editing, mixing, bouncing, recording, I have been stressing DP7 a lot. Only one crash on a program start up and the fact the Schwa SchOPE plug doesn´t work, so I unabled it.
If DP7.02 would be an airoplain I´d dear to fly it intercontinental :D

Just wanted to resurrect this in case anyone is still sitting on the fence! I just upgraded to DP 7.02 and ok, it's been less than 24 hours but it's beautiful so far!
I went from 5.13 and on my limited machine 7 is performing better than 5.13.
A few minor bugs I had with 5 seem to have vanished and VI's are working better.
My last big project opened and played perfectly.
I'm on a single core G5 and it's pretty amazing that jumping from DP 5 to 7 did not require a new computer considering all the mac processor advancements.
I don't even find the GUI too bright!
I'm going to hold off on upgrading to 7.1 since it may tax my system and I can't really see any must-have features.
I even gained a tuner in 7.02 as a free AU tuner which did not work in 5 has been resurrected in 7.
The only problem I have is losing the GUI on Stillwell Rocket compressor which I see is mentioned in another thread.
I know it's been said before but 7 is probably the best update yet.

:idea: If you upgrade to DP 7.1 and return to DP 7.02 (without uninstalling DP7.1) you can use DPs new Tuner in DP 7.02 and all the new Amp presets too. I went back and use them in DP 7.02.
